Milling in New Hampshire

New Hampshire's precision milling industry is one of New England's best-kept manufacturing secrets—a dense cluster of precision machine shops concentrated in the Merrimack Valley and Seacoast regions serving defense, aerospace, medical device, and high-technology customers at world-class precision levels. The state's proximity to Boston's technology economy and Massachusetts's defense supply chains, combined with lower New Hampshire operating costs, creates an exceptional value proposition for precision milling buyers. Defense Electronics and Aerospace Milling in the Nashua-Manchester Corridor

New Hampshire's Nashua and Manchester manufacturing corridor serves BAE Systems, Raytheon supply chains, and defense electronics companies with AS9100-certified precision milling at Massachusetts-comparable quality levels. Electronics housing milling, structural defense component production, and precision aerospace hardware are produced in facilities that draw engineering talent from the broader Boston metropolitan area. The proximity to BAE Systems' Manchester operations—which produce electronic warfare systems, radar components, and aircraft survivability equipment—has created a local supply chain of shops experienced with BAE Systems-specific quality requirements and defense program management expectations. Many shops maintain dual-use capability, serving both classified defense programs and commercial medical or industrial customers to balance workload and reduce program dependency risk.

Submarine Support Milling for Portsmouth Naval Shipyard

Portsmouth Naval Shipyard's submarine overhaul and maintenance operations—one of only four active Navy shipyards in the country—create demand for precision milled replacement components under Navy SUBSAFE and nuclear quality program standards. Greater Portsmouth area shops serve this demand with stainless steel and specialty alloy milling for submarine hull system components, propulsion hardware, and shipboard system equipment. New Hampshire shops serving Portsmouth's submarine program community understand the extended documentation and process control requirements of Navy nuclear and SUBSAFE work—requirements that go significantly beyond commercial precision manufacturing quality systems. These shops maintain specialized quality management systems, material control programs, and inspection records that satisfy Navy quality engineering oversight.

Merrimack Valley Precision Milling for Medical and Technology Programs

The Merrimack Valley gives New Hampshire milling suppliers access to the same engineering ecosystem that supports Boston's medical device, robotics, optics, and defense electronics markets. Nashua, Manchester, Londonderry, and surrounding towns host shops that can take prototype work from nearby engineering teams and carry it into controlled low-volume production. That proximity is valuable when a component needs several design iterations before it is ready for a stable production release. Medical and technology milling in this corridor often involves small aluminum and stainless housings, precision pockets, thermal features, thin walls, threaded inserts, and datum structures that must align with electronics, sensors, or sterile assemblies. ISO 13485 capability is important for device components, but even non-medical buyers benefit from the inspection habits and revision control developed in regulated work. New Hampshire's cost structure matters because buyers can stay within a same-day engineering travel radius of Boston without paying the full overhead of a Massachusetts supplier. For procurement teams, the strongest use case is not low-spec commodity machining; it is precision milling where engineering access, documentation, and price discipline all need to coexist.
